- Satellogic published a fourth-quarter and full-year 2025 earnings release, reporting Q4 revenue of USD 6.2 million, up 94% on higher imagery orders from Data & Analytics customers.
- Full-year revenue rose 38% to USD 17.7 million, driven primarily by increased imagery orders from new and existing Data & Analytics customers.
- Q4 net income was USD 30.5 million, reflecting a USD 36.7 million net gain from changes in the fair value of financial instruments.
- Full-year net loss narrowed 96% to USD 4.78 million, while non-GAAP adjusted EBITDA loss improved 48% to USD 17.43 million.
- Cash and cash equivalents totaled USD 94.43 million at year-end, and management said a fully funded Merlin constellation backed by a USD 30 million customer contract is targeted for a first launch in October 2026.
